Quote by Muddy Waters

“I was always singing the way I felt, and maybe I didn't exactly know it, but I just didn't like the way things were down there-in Mississippi.”

Muddy Waters

Muddy Waters, born McKinley Morganfield, was a legendary American blues musician, often referred to as the 'Father of Modern Blues'. Born on April 4, 1913, in Mississippi, he passed away on April 30, 1983.
